    Kofi Adomah’s Eye Incident: Why is the police silent?

    Media personality MC Yaa Yeboah has expressed shock at the police’s silence following Kofi Adomah’s eye shooting incident during a festival in Dormaa.

    Speaking on the ‘United Showbiz’ on UTV, she questioned why the police has since remained inactive, with no arrests made.

    She also questioned why the individual who fired the musket at the festival, leading to Kofi Adomah’s eye being injured, is walking freely despite clear laws on the use of muskets, while the victim (Kofi) is left to suffer.

    MC Yaa Yeboah compared this case to other incidents, such as the remand of a man who shot a female chief and the prosecution of actor LilWin after a fatal car crash.

    She analysed the events and demanded to know why Kofi Adomah’s case is being treated differently.

    “It is so strange that at an event meant to celebrate a festival, someone would take a gun and shoot another person, and they would say it was an accident. What is going on? Is someone holding them back?” she asked.

    She further questioned whether the inactivity by the police was due to higher powers preventing them from doing their job, stating, “Why is it that the police are yet to act on a matter where there are clearly laws on musket usage? Did someone tell them not to do anything? What is going on? Is someone holding them back?”

    What happened?

    On December 21, 2024, broadcaster Kofi Adomah was accidentally shot in both eyes by a musket during a traditional ceremony in Dormaa Ahenkro, requiring emergency treatment in Ghana before being flown to Dubai and later the UK for specialised care.

    While some public support poured in through donations, Kofi Adomah and his wife later accused his employer, Angel FM CEO Vincent Opare, and the Dormaa chiefs of neglect.
